Appian Enterprise enables customers to automate, execute and optimize cross-functional business processes from beginning to end. This empowers business users to integrate operational and customer-related data systems from existing internal enterprise systems. "The selection of Appian Enterprise was the result of an exhaustive review of a number of the leading BPM providers that included a very detailed hands-on proof of concept demonstration," stated Donald Davidoff, Archstone-Smith group vice president, pricing and revenue management. "Appian's out of the box functionality, combined with its integrated document management and next generation forms design capability, proved to be the platform that best met the needs of our growing business."
